To find the possible dimensions of the rectangle, we need to factor the given trinomial, x^2 + 7x - 30.
The factored form of the trinomial can be written as (x + m)(x + n), where m and n are the possible factors of -30 that add up to 7.
Factors of -30: ±1, ±2, ±3, ±5, ±6, ±10, ±15, ±30
Possible combinations to achieve a sum of 7:
-3 and 10
Therefore, the factored form of x^2 + 7x - 30 is (x - 3)(x + 10).
The possible dimensions of the rectangle are (x - 3) and (x + 10) , so the correct answer is A) (x + 10) and (x - 3).
